About PivotHack
PivotHack is China’s first high school student-led nation-wide hackathon, dedicated to fostering innovation and collaboration among young tech enthusiasts. Founded in 2025, PivotHack was conceived by three high school students who recognized the need for a platform that encourages creativity and collaboration for China's teenage dreamers, doers, and changers. With help and resources from the school and sponsors, we turned that vision into reality in three months.

Theme and Impact
PivotHack centered on the theme of AI-for-Good, inviting participants to confront emerging challenges in AI ethics, education, and accessibility. Rather than treating artificial intelligence as abstraction, we encouraged teams to prototype tangible, socially grounded solutions.
The hackathon attracted over 50 applicants from across the country, with 28 talented participants admitted to form 7 teams and work on their projects. During the event, the contestants spent 48 hours on-campus with full accommodation and meals, collaborating intensively to develop their prototypes. The hackathon culminated in final presentations to a panel of venture capitalists, industry mentors, and educators, who offered critical feedback and potential pathways toward further development and funding.
